CELEBRATE CINCO DE MAYO WITH DINING SPECIALS

Dine-in with Casino Arizona and Talking Stick Resort

SALT RIVER PIMA-MARICOPA INDIAN COMMUNITY, Ariz. (April 29, 2021) – Celebrate Cinco de Mayo at Casino Arizona and Talking Stick Resort with dining options available at each property. On Wednesday, May 5, invite your friends and family to dine-in at select restaurants featuring delicious Mexican-food dishes. 

The following is a list of each restaurant’s offerings:

Casino Arizona:

CAZ SPORTS BAR

The CAZ Sports Bar Cinco de Mayo meal will kick off with a choice of Mexican street corn soup or salad. Followed by Creamy Green Chile Chicken Enchiladas served with cilantro rice pilaf and spicy refried beans. For dessert, Dulce De Leche Sundae will be served with Mexican caramel sauce, chocolate sauce, vanilla bean ice cream and caramel popcorn, $15.95.

BINGO HALL

Casino Arizona’s Bingo Hall will offer three Chicken Enchiladas. The enchiladas feature marinated chicken breast with cheese, wrapped in corn tortillas and smothered with red enchilada sauce. The dish is served with a side of refried beans, Spanish rice, pico de gallo and sour cream. Dessert is a slice of Tres Leches Cake, $10.50.

SALT RIVER CAFE

Delicious Cinco de Mayo specials will run all day from 11 a.m. to 9 p.m. at Salt River Café. Guests will enjoy Carne Asada Tacos or Pork Tacos Al Pastor with Spanish rice, refried beans, sour cream, guacamole and pico de gallo. Dessert will feature Margarita Meringue Tarts, $8.95. 

THE WILLOWS RESTAURANT

The Willows Restaurant will feature a breakfast and dinner Cinco de Mayo Special. Breakfast will be from 6 a.m. to 11 a.m. and will feature a Beef Machacha Omelet with slow cooked shredded beef and chiles in a three-egg omelet topped with pepper jack cheese and a side of hash browns for $10.95. A three-course dinner special will run from 11 a.m. to 9 p.m. and will start off with Chicken Tortilla Soup. Pork Carnitas Chimichanga will be served for dessert with a side of refried black beans and Spanish rice, $12.95. Dessert will be a Honey Flan, $4.

Talking Stick Resort:

BLUE COYOTE CANTINA

Enjoy a two-course meal at Blue Coyote Cantina for $24. Huarache will be served as an entrée with beer braised short ribs, refried black beans, shredded lettuce, avocado, sour cream, cotija cheese, radishes and fresh salsa verde. Desert will feature Capirotada with brioche cubes, gingersnaps, dried fruits and serrano peppers in a cinnamon chile infused pudding with crème Mexicana.

Talking Stick Resort

Talking Stick Resort (TSR) is a AAA Four Diamond Rated Resort and a central landmark within the emerging Talking Stick Cultural and Entertainment Destination (TSCED). Located in Scottsdale, Ariz., just east of the Loop 101 on Talking Stick Way, TSR is locally owned and caringly operated by the Salt River Pima-Maricopa Indian Community. The property offers culturally rich experiences and luxury accommodations throughout its 496 deluxe rooms, nearly 300,000 sq. ft. casino, 11 restaurants and lounges, world-class spa, 650-seat showroom, 25,000 sq. ft. grand ballroom, thriving cultural center and more than 113,000 sq. ft. of indoor and outdoor meeting space.
